The Sutler Saloon Kicks Off Seven Days of Bluegrass Brunch

The Sutler Saloon’s popular Bluegrass Brunch is an institution for those who enjoy pickin’ and grinnin’ and drinkin'. Normally only offered on Saturday and Sunday from 10 a.m.  to 3 p.m., in honor of the holidays it will be available for an entire week as part of “Seven Days of Bluegrass Brunch.”

If you don’t feel like cooking over the holidays or you have some friends in from out of town that you’d like to entertain, check out this Melrose stalwart for a full menu of brunchy treats, ranging from shrimp-and-grits to chicken-and-waffles. They also offer bottomless mimosas (which sounds like they’ll spill all over your table) and a bloody mary bar so you can spice up your drink to your stomach’s content. Of course, it wouldn’t be a Bluegrass Brunch without jangling banjos, so you can expect live entertainment throughout. If you have to wait for a table, you’re invited to start taking advantage of the continuous mimosas next door in the basement at the Melrose Billiard Parlor until it’s time to take your table.

The Sutler’s Holiday Bluegrass Brunch will be available from Dec. 26 through Jan. 1.
